The PRO-SAFE PLXR-1218 is a rectangular convex safety mirror designed for indoor and outdoor use in traffic, inspection, and surveillance applications. The mirror features an acrylic lens that provides a wide-angle view of hard-to-see areas, helping workers and drivers spot hazards around blind corners, in warehouses, parking structures, and along loading docks. Standing 12 inches high and 18 inches wide, it covers a maximum viewing distance of 16 feet. The rubber frame and handle provide a durable grip, while the laminated hardboard backing adds structural stability. Installation is straightforward for facility maintenance staff, safety coordinators, or trade professionals handling site safety equipment.
The PLXR-1218 is suited for both indoor environments such as warehouses, retail stockrooms, and manufacturing floors, and outdoor locations including parking areas, driveways, and building entrances. Its convex lens geometry compresses a broad field of view into a single glance, making it practical for traffic control points and inspection lanes where visibility around obstructions is critical. The acrylic construction resists shattering compared to glass alternatives, making it appropriate for high-traffic or impact-prone environments.

Facility maintenance personnel or safety equipment installers typically mount convex safety mirrors to walls, posts, or ceilings using appropriate hardware for the mounting surface. Confirm the mounting substrate can support the weight of the mirror before installation. For outdoor installations, ensure all fasteners and mounting brackets are rated for exterior exposure. No electrical work or trade licensing is required for standard mirror installation.
